In demography there is a term called “sub-replacement fertility.” The sub-replacement fertility refers to fertility below 2.1-2.2 children per woman. Replacement fertility is typically 2.1-2.2 and higher, because this replaces the two parents and adds population to compensate for deaths. Many European and East Asian countries now have lower birth rates than death rates which leads to aging population and eventually to a decline, if the fertility rate does not change and sustained mass immigration does not occur.

In developed countries, sub-replacement fertility is any rate below approximately 2.1 children born per woman, which is simply not sufficient to sustain let alone to lead to an increase of the population. As of 2010, about 48 percent (3.3 billion people) of the world population lives in nations with sub-replacement fertility. Nonetheless most of these countries still experience growing populations due to immigration and increase of the life expectancy. This includes most nations of Europe, the United States, Canada, Australia, and New Zealand. As of 2015, all European Union countries had a sub-replacement fertility rate, ranging from a low of 1.31 in Portugal to a “high” of 1.96 in France.

While Europe’s population over the past fifty years has grown by about a quarter, from 400 million people in 1960 to around 500 million at the start of this decade, the European population growth has slowed, and some countries have even recorded negative growth, such as Germany and the Eastern European countries, for example. And if there is any growth at all, like in France and Great Britain, it is due to the migration from Asia and Africa, in order to come to the point that currently the non-indigenous population comprises some ten percent of Europe’s population.

Population aging may pose an economic challenge to governments, as the number of retired citizens drawing public pensions rises in relation to the number of workers. This has been raised as a political issue in the European Union where many people have advocated policy changes to encourage higher birth and immigration rates, as replacement fertility well above the critical rate would be most beneficial for the European budget. However, sub-replacement fertility does not automatically lead to a population decline, as long as there is immigration.

From this merger a new union was born: the Union for the Mediterranean (UfM) probably as a first step towards the creation of Mediterranean Union, Thus, the European Union (EU) “acquired” a larger territory than the territory the Roman Empire conquered by wars.

The Secretariat of the Union for the Mediterranean (UfM) was created by 43 Euro-Mediterranean Heads of State and Government in 2008 with its headquarters in Barcelona, Spain. Officially, the Union for the Mediterranean was design to be a multilateral partnership aiming at increasing the potential for regional integration and cohesion among the 28 EU member states and 15 Mediterranean countries. The Union for the Mediterranean (UfM) had expressed a desire to grant Libya full membership, but that was the intent before the war. A partner in the Union for the Mediterranean (UfM) was also the League of Arab States (Egypt, Iraq, Jordan, Lebanon, Saudi Arabia, Syria, and Yemen).

Thus, it seems that the Union for the Mediterranean (UfM) was meant to expand and become a union of the European Union, the north-African countries from the African Union (AU), and the Middle East Union (MEU), aka MENA; at least that was their intent.
